WASHINGTON — Kamala Harris isn’t ruling out another run for the White House. In an interview with the BBC posted Saturday, Harris said she expects a woman will be president in the coming years, and it could “possibly” be her. “I am not done,” she said.

Harris previously said that her near future would not be in "elected office" but has not ruled out a third bid for the White House.
During the wide-ranging conversation, Harris also took aim at Trump, accusing him of fulfilling warnings that he would use federal power for political retribution. “He said he would weaponize the Department of Justice, and he has done exactly that,” Harris told the BBC.
